Average Education Administrators, Postsecondary Salary in Richmond, VA
Education Administrators at postsecondary institutions in Richmond, VA, command an impressive average annual salary of $152,380. This figure significantly surpasses the national average of $120,180, indicating a strong local demand and potentially higher responsibilities or a more competitive market for these specialized roles within the Richmond area.
Executive Summary
- Average Salary: $152,380 per year.
-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 0.1% ↗ over the last 5 years.
-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$228,570.
- Outlook: With a local workforce of 500 Education Administrators, Postsecondary, Richmond presents a moderate but stable employment landscape. The Location Quotient of 0.67 suggests that while this profession is not as concentrated as the national average, the presence of a dedicated workforce of this size points to established institutions and ongoing needs within the sector.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 500 employees in the Richmond, VA area with a job density of 0.771 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
